An All Terrain Travel System generally combines a stroller with a safety seat, enhanced for different environments. Unlike basic strollers, the all-terrain version is created to manage different barriers-- be it sand, gravel, yard, or even snow-- while also ensuring that young guests remain safe and secure and comfortable.
Robust Wheels: The hallmark feature of an all-terrain system is its long lasting wheels-- typically air-filled and large enough to take on varied surface areas without problem.
Suspension Systems: Many designs come geared up with innovative suspension systems that provide a smoother ride for both baby and parent.
Compact Design: Families are often on the go and require travel systems that are easy to fold and stash, while still being strong.
Safety Features: All Terrain Travel Systems need to have five-point harnesses, brake systems, and other security components to make sure kid defense.
Comfort Amenities: Look for adjustable seats, sunshades, and storage compartments to improve the travel experience.

When choosing an All Terrain Buggies Terrain Travel System, a number of elements should be taken into account:
Age Range and Weight Limit: Ensure the system appropriates for your child's age, weight, and height.
Terrain Compatibility: Assess the types of surfaces you will primarily browse-- some systems stand out on specific surface areas more than others.
Budget plan: Weigh the expense versus the features and quality of the system.
Relieve of Use: Look for functions that allow simple setup and breakdown, especially if taking a trip typically.
Brand Reputation: Research brand names known for their reliability, security records, and customer support.
